Security Software Engineer
Há 2 dias
*Native/Bilingual English is required for this role (read/written/spoken) Please upload your CV Resume in English. Monthly salary: $6,000 USD Along with our partner, we are seeking a security-conscious contract Senior level Software Engineer to help enhance the security posture of their applications. The primary focus of this role is to systematically reduce their attack surface by addressing high-priority security risks. Using Snyk as the primary scanning tool, this engineer will be responsible for identifying, prioritizing, and remediating dependencies with known exploitable vulnerabilities. The goal is a targeted reduction of risk, not a simple "update-all" approach. Role & Responsibilities: The engineer will be responsible for the following: Vulnerability Analysis: Analyze the results of Snyk scans of their codebases (Ruby, Go, Python, JavaScript). Prioritization: Critically assess Snyk reports to distinguish between theoretical vulnerabilities and those that are genuinely exploitable within the context of their applications. Targeted Remediation: Plan and execute targeted dependency upgrades or apply patches specifically to fix the prioritized exploitable vulnerabilities, ensuring minimal disruption to the system. Code & Test Validation: Refactor code and update unit/integration tests as necessary to support the upgraded dependencies and validate the fixes. Collaboration & Documentation: Work closely with internal security and engineering teams, participate in code reviews, and clearly document the rationale for each remediation. Required Skills & Qualifications (Must-Haves): Candidates must have demonstrable, hands-on experience in the following areas: Security Tooling: Proven professional experience using Snyk to identify, prioritize, and manage vulnerabilities in a production environment. Candidate must be able to interpret Snyk's findings, including exploit maturity and reachability. Strong professional experience with all of the following languages: ○ Ruby (including Ruby on Rails) ○ Go ○ Python ○ JavaScript ○ TypeScript Deep expertise with package managers for each ecosystem (e.G., package.Json, Go Modules, Pip/Poetry, NPM/Yarn). Version Control: Expert-level proficiency with Git. Automated Testing: A strong commitment to quality with proven experience in writing comprehensive tests. Preferred Qualifications (Nice-to-Haves): While not mandatory, preference will be given to candidates with experience in: Other Security Tools: Familiarity with other SAST/SCA tools (e.G., GitHub Advanced Security, Checkmarx, Trivy). CI/CD Integration: Experience integrating security tools like Snyk into CI/CD pipelines (e.G., Jenkins, GitLab CI, GitHub Actions). Containerization: Experience with Docker and container orchestration (e.G., Kubernetes). Benefits: A fully remote position, allowing for work-life balance. The opportunity to be a part of a mission-driven company that is committed to taking care of its employees. Two weeks of paid vacation per year 10 paid days for local holidays Work Schedule : US Eastern Standard Time *Please note this role is currently for a 3-month project with the potential for a long-term position.
-
Security Software Engineer
Há 4 dias
Belo Horizonte, Brasil Tecla Tempo inteiro*Native/Bilingual English is required for this role (read/written/spoken)Please upload your CV Resume in English.Monthly salary: $6,000 USDAlong with our partner, we are seeking a security-conscious contract Senior level Software Engineer to help enhance the security posture of their applications. The primary focus of this role is to systematically reduce...
-
Linux Cryptography And Security Engineer
2 semanas atrás
Belo Horizonte, Brasil Canonical Tempo inteiroLinux Cryptography and Security EngineerJoin or sign in to find your next jobJoin to apply for the Linux Cryptography and Security Engineer role at CanonicalLinux Cryptography and Security Engineer3 days ago Be among the first 25 applicantsJoin to apply for the Linux Cryptography and Security Engineer role at CanonicalGet AI-powered advice on this job and...
-
Linux Cryptography and Security Engineer
2 semanas atrás
Belo Horizonte, Brasil Canonical Tempo inteiroLinux Cryptography and Security EngineerJoin or sign in to find your next job Join to apply for the Linux Cryptography and Security Engineer role at Canonical Linux Cryptography and Security Engineer3 days ago Be among the first 25 applicants Join to apply for the Linux Cryptography and Security Engineer role at Canonical Get AI-powered advice on this job...
-
Senior Network Consulting Engineer
1 semana atrás
Belo Horizonte, Brasil Layer2 Network Consulting Tempo inteiroRole Summary We are seeking a Senior Network Consulting Engineer (NCE) – Security to join our team and support mission-critical security projects.This role requires deep hands-on expertise in Cisco Firepower Threat Defense (FTD) and Cisco Identity Services Engine (ISE), combined with strong consulting and troubleshooting skills to resolve complex issues in...
-
Senior Network Consulting Engineer
Há 3 dias
Belo Horizonte, Brasil Layer2 Network Consulting Tempo inteiroRole Summary We are seeking a Senior Network Consulting Engineer (NCE) – Security to join our team and support mission‑critical security projects. This role requires deep hands‑on expertise in Cisco Firepower Threat Defense (FTD) and Cisco Identity Services Engine (ISE), combined with strong consulting and troubleshooting skills to resolve complex...
-
Software Engineer
2 semanas atrás
Belo Horizonte, Brasil International Digital Partners Tempo inteiroSoftware Engineer – AI Contract: 6–12 months (extendable) Location: Remote – Nearshore (EST hours preferred) Overview Our client is looking for a highly skilled and experienced Software Engineer – AI to join the engineering team. The ideal candidate will have strong hands-on experience building full-stack applications (80% backend / 20% frontend) ,...
-
Lead Golang Software Engineer, Commercial Systems
2 semanas atrás
Belo Horizonte, Brasil Canonical Tempo inteiroLead Golang Software Engineer, Commercial SystemsJoin or sign in to find your next job Join to apply for the Lead Golang Software Engineer, Commercial Systems role at Canonical Lead Golang Software Engineer, Commercial Systems3 days ago Be among the first 25 applicants Join to apply for the Lead Golang Software Engineer, Commercial Systems role at Canonical...
-
Ubuntu Security Engineer
1 semana atrás
Belo Horizonte, Brasil Canonical Tempo inteiroOverview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Canonical is building a team dedicated to providing security coverage...
-
Cyber Security Engineer
1 semana atrás
Belo Horizonte, Brasil Tata Consultancy Services Tempo inteiroCome to one of the biggest IT Services companies in the world!!Here you can transform your career!Why to join TCS?Here at TCS we believe that people make the difference, that's why we live a culture of unlimited learning full of opportunities for improvement and mutual development.The ideal scenario to expand ideas through the right tools, contributing to...
-
Data Security Engineer
Há 6 dias
Belo Horizonte, Brasil New Era Technology Tempo inteiroJoin our team as a ¡MS Purview Data Security Engineer – Email Security!. We're searching for someone who has fresh ideas and a unique viewpoint, and who enjoys collaborating with a cross-functional team to develop real-world solutions and positive user experiences for every interaction. Required Technical Skills: BS in Computer Science, Information...